Steam Turbines are one of GE’s core products for clean energy generation. When used in combined cycle plants they enable the achievement of utmost efficiency and power. Whether the plant operates on liquid or gaseous fuels, carbon neutral e-fuels or hydrogen, steam turbines significantly drive decarbonization. While steam turbines themselves are CO2 free, they also enable traditional combined-cycle plants to reduce carbon emissions through carbon capture capabilities. The NPI Delivery Bucket/Blade Aeromechanic Engineer within the Steam Turbine is responsible for designing and implementing both rotating and stationary bucket/blade technologies enabling world-class performance and reliability for steam turbines. This is a critical role requiring both system level knowledge of turbomachinery safety (overspeed) and detailed mechanical component expertise to design steam turbines for new customer orders and service upgrade opportunities.
